Exquisitely presented and brimming with captivating charm is this delightful three-bedroom Victorian home located on the tree-lined residential street Barretts Grove, N16.

Encompassing a generous expanse of close to 1,500 square feet, the property includes a spacious double-reception room adorned with an original fireplace and a bay window. The stylish kitchen is equally impressive, providing a generous area for dining and entertaining. Moreover, it seamlessly connects to secluded rear garden which benefits from a south-facing aspect ensuring beautiful natural light throughout the day. The upper levels play host to three well-proportioned bedrooms and an elegant family bathroom complete with free-standing tub and separate shower. The lower level offers a multi-functional space which is currently being utilised as an additional reception but could easily be converted to an additional bedroom or study. Further benefits include a large storage space on this level.

Barretts Grove is enviably located in central Stoke Newington and within walking distance of all the bars, restaurants, cafes, and independently owned shops which both Newington Green and Kingsland High Street have to offer. Stoke Newington itself is renowned as a family hotspot due to the combination of excellent schooling options (both primary and secondary) and a plethora of recreational activities available in the nearby Clissold Park. The property is within walking distance of the vibrant hotspots of London Fields, Broadway Market and Stoke Newington Church Street. With Dalston Junction and Dalston Kingsland Stations just a stone's throw away, residents can enjoy swift access to Shoreditch and Highbury & Islington (Victoria Line). The City is accessible via numerous and frequent bus routes.

This exceptional property is offered with no onward chain.
